We are partnering with a leading global financial institution to recruit an experienced Derivatives Negotiator to join a high-performing legal team supporting derivatives and fixed income activities across EMEA. The role will involve close collaboration with trading, risk, and structuring teams, ensuring documentation is robust, compliant, and aligned with the organisation's risk appetite.


Client Details


Our client is a well-established international investment banking group with a strong presence across major global markets. The firm is recognised for its disciplined approach to risk management, collaborative culture, and commitment to delivering high-quality solutions to a diverse client base. The legal function operates as a strategic partner to the business, working across jurisdictions and product areas.


Description

  • Lead the negotiation and execution of derivatives documentation including master agreements, collateral arrangements, and related legal documentation
  • Provide clear, commercially focused legal guidance on complex or bespoke derivatives transactions
  • Partner closely with front office teams to facilitate transaction execution while managing legal and regulatory risks
  • Support the development and refinement of internal legal policies, frameworks, and best practices
  • Identify and assess legal and regulatory developments, advising on potential impacts to the business
  • Contribute to cross-border transactions, coordinating with colleagues and external parties across multiple jurisdictions

Profile


  • Significant experience (appx. 10+ years) within derivatives legal or documentation negotiation roles
  • Strong knowledge of derivatives documentation (e.g., ISDA Master Agreements, CSAs) and relevant regulatory frameworks
  • Exposure to multiple jurisdictions (e.g. UK, Europe, US, Asia) and cross-border transactions
  • Experience working with a wide range of counterparties including financial institutions, corporates, and funds


Job Offer

  • Day rate up to £800 via umbrella depending on candidate experience
  • Hybrid working in Central London, 2 - 3 days per week in office
  • 12 month FTC with the potential to extend
